Ringelberg v. Vanguard Integrity Professionals -Nevada, Inc. et al

Filing 121

ORDER. IT IS ORDERED that 109 Steven Cash's Second Motion for Withdrawal of Counsel for plaintiff is GRANTED. Steven Cash shall be removed from the CMECF service list. Plaintiff shall continue to be represented by Richard Alan Mescon of Leichtman Law PLLC and local counsel Daniel D. Norr of the Law Office of Daniel Norr, LLC. Signed by Magistrate Judge Peggy A. Leen on 3/21/2018. (Copies have been distributed pursuant to the NEF - ADR)
